Sniff, a toy for sight-impaired children, by Sara Johansson The dog’s nose contains an RFID reader. When it detects RFID-tagged objects, it gives sound and tactile feedback—a unique response for each object. Designed by Sara Johansson, a student in the Tangible Interaction course at the Oslo School of Architecture and Design, under the instruction of tutors Timo Arnall and Mosse Sjaastad.Photo courtesy of Sara Johansson.
